" This detached two bedroom bungalow is situated on the coast road giving easy access to the main town centre, Prestatyn and further afield via the A55 expressway, local amenities are closeby and the sea front is within walking distance. The property briefly comprises; larger than average entrance porch/sun room, Inner hallway, lounge, kitchen, disabled friendly shower room and two double bedrooms, outside the property has driveway parking with enclosed easily maintainable front garden and private rear garden. This stands in a popular position and internal viewing is recommended. EPC rating E.


Accommodation
Double glazed front door gives access into the Porch/Sun room.

Porch/Sun Room - 12' 2'' x 5' 2'' (3.71m x 1.57m)
With a radiator, laminate flooring and double glazed windows to the front and side of the property and a glazed door into the inner hallway. This could be utilised as a sun room or a porch area.

Hallway
With a continuation of the laminate flooring and radiator.

Lounge - 13' 6'' x 9' 5'' to bay (4.11m x 2.87m)
Having a feature timber fire surround with marble effect back and hearth and a living flame gas fire inset, continuation of the laminate flooring, radiator, TV connection, phone point and double glazed bay window overlooking the front of the property.

Kitchen - 8' 10'' x 7' 11'' (2.69m x 2.41m)
Having a range of modern wall, drawer and base units with complimentary worktop surface over, single drainer sink with mixer tap over, fitted electric oven and hob with extractor fan over, void for washing machine, concealed central heating boiler and tiled walls and flooring. Double glazed window and double glazed door onto the side of the property.

Bedroom One - 12' 10'' x 10' 2'' (3.91m x 3.10m)
With radiator, built-in mirrored wardrobes and double glazed window overlooking the rear garden.

Bedroom Two - 11' 2'' x 8' 9'' (3.40m x 2.66m)
With radiator, laminate flooring and double glazed window overlooking the rear garden.

Shower room - 8' 0'' x 5' 5'' (2.44m x 1.65m)
This is disabled friendly and benefits from non slip flooring and grab rails, the shower enclosure has bi-folding doors gives easy access to the double shower tray, pedestal wash hand basin and push button toilet. Tiled walls, heated towel rail and double glazed twin obscured windows.

Outside
The front is enclosed and offers off road parking with timber gated access to the rear garden which is mainly laid to lawn mature trees and shrubs with further space to the side of the bungalow.
